Property damage accident at US-20 and NY-155 intersection, Guilderland NY
A vehicle accident causing property damage occurred at the intersection of US-20 and NY-155. The caller initially reported being unable to open their car door or exit the vehicle, suggesting possible entrapment. Emergency responders confirmed that there was no entrapment.
